Fla. Admin. Code Ann. R. 59A-5.022 - Physical Plant Requirements for Ambulatory Surgical Centers
(1) The Agency provides technical assistance
to the Florida Building Commission and the State Fire Marshal in developing and
maintaining standards for the design and construction of ambulatory surgical
centers. These standards are included in the following:
(a) The building codes in Rule
61G20-1.001, F.A.C.; as adopted
by the Florida Building Commission.
(b) The fire codes in Chapter 69A-60, F.A.C.;
as adopted by the State Fire Marshal.
(c) The handicap accessibility standards in
Chapter 553, Part V, F.S. and Rule
61G20-4.002, F.A.C; as adopted
by the Florida Building Commission.
(2) No building shall be converted to a
licensed ambulatory surgical center unless it complies with the standards and
codes in effect when the building is converted.
(3) Local codes which set more stringent
standards or add additional requirements shall take precedence over these
standards and requirements as set forth in this section. Contact the Office of
Plans and Construction when conflicts occur.
Notes
Rulemaking Authority 395.1055 FS. Law Implemented 395.1055 FS.
New 6-14-78, Formerly 10D-30.22, Amended 2-3-88, Formerly 10D-30.022, Amended 6-11-97, 7-9-15.
